Men's Hoops Overcome Lourdes in Final Regular Season Game

Men's Hoops Overcome Lourdes in Final Regular Season Game

SYLVANIA, Ohio – The Siena Heights men's basketball team held-on to overcome Lourdes (Ohio) in the regular season finale, winning 68-65 on Saturday.

Siena Heights held on to a seven point lead at the end of the first half, 37-30.

Going into the second half, the Gray Wolves (10-19, 5-17) came out strong slowly gaining on the Saints' lead. With 00:26 remaining on the clock, E.J. Blackwell made two free throws to put LU on top for the first time of the night, 65-64. With 13 seconds left, Christopher Pearl sank a lay-up to get the Saints on top for good. Jerrell Martin sank a pair of free throws as insurance to SHU's three point victory.

Pearl led the Saints with 20 points and seven rebounds. Jerrell Martin added 19 points and six boards while Myles Copeland tacked on 17 points and six rebounds.

Blackwell was the leading scorer of the night, finishing with 26 points. Zach Steinmetz was close behind with 23 points and eight rebounds.

As a team, Siena Heights shot 18-44 (40.9 percent) on the floor, 3-12 (25.0 percent) behind the arc and 29-38 (76.3 percent) from the charity stripe. The Gray Wolves finished 24-49 (49.0 percent) from the field, 4-13 (30.8 percent) in three-point land and 13-18 (72.2 percent) in free throws.

The Saints (10-20, 6-16) await their placement in the post-season WHAC Tournament. The first round is Wednesday, Feb 24; semifinals are Saturday, Feb. 27; the Championship is Monday, Feb.29.
